CVE-2024-3884Network attack vector

Remote denial of service via unbounded form parsing

Published Dec 3, 2025 · Updated Sep 4, 2026

Denial of service in Undertow within Red Hat JBoss EAP 7 and 8 allows remote attackers to exhaust memory with large form bodies. FormEncodedDataDefinition.doParse(StreamSourceChannel) accumulates application/x-www-form-urlencoded data without a size limit until JVM heap is exhausted. Exploitation requires an externally reachable servlet or class to invoke this parser without upper-layer size validation, causing the application server to terminate or become unavailable.
